Hey Priya — handing over the Lumenpay rounding saga before I'm out. Short version: the converter truncates instead of banker's-rounding on ILS-to-krona paths, so totals drift by a cent on big batches. Fix is merged behind the fx_round_v2 flag; please don't cut the release until the reconciliation job finishes its backfill. If the deploy tooling asks you to unlock the finance config vault mid-release, you'll need the recovery passphrase, which I'm leaving right below this note.

recovery phrase for baweg-faweg: zorael-framir

# --- Circuit breaker: Ortmill upstream API ---
# Trips after 5 consecutive failures; half-open probe every 30s.
# When open, requests fall back to the cached response table and
# a stale-data banner is shown. Do not raise the failure threshold
# without checking Ortmill's status page first — flapping here
# cascades into the order queue. Breaker state and fallback cache
# are persisted in the database at the connection string below.

replica DSN, kajep-yahag: mssql://praok_svc:iF@db-8d68.plorvaio.local:5432/eliion

Subject: Quickstore 4.2 — bloom filter now fronts the KV layer

Plugin authors: starting with this release, Quickstore places a bloom filter ahead of the key-value store. Negative lookups return faster; false positives fall through safely. No API changes are required on your side. Verify your plugin against the staging build referenced below.

session token of fahif-tadup = htk3_9c7

#
# Welcome aboard. This module drives the nightly backfill runs for the
# Corvane warehouse pipeline. Jobs are picked up in priority order after
# the 02:00 ingest freeze, and each partition is retried with exponential
# backoff before being parked for manual review. Don't change windows
# without checking with the Marlowood data team first, since downstream
# dashboards assume fresh data by 06:30. The tuning constants below
# control concurrency, retry ceilings, and the freeze window. Adjust them
# only after reading the runbook.

tuning table, kajog-bawip:
TIERS = {
    "kelius": 256,
    "lammir": 543,
}